Bug#465418: Impossible to browse my phone
Package: gnome-bluetooth Version: 0.9.1-1 Severity: important --- Please enter the report below this line. --- Hi, I've just test to browse my phone (Sony Ericsson K750i) using gnome-bluetooth. To do that, I've done : * right-click on tray icon * choose "browse device..." * select my phone in the list, then click on "connect" button Then a Nautilus window opens on my desktop with the following directories : - "Mémoire téléphone" - "Memory Stick" If I click on one of this one, a new window opens with the same directories (same name). If I click on one of these ones, I have the following error (translated from french): Impossible to show directory content : "Memory Stick" is not found. It could have been deleted recently. in console With doing simple : $ mkdir foo $ hcitool scan > 00:0E:07:B0:0F:CD K750i $ obexfs -b 00:0E:07:B0:0F:CD foo $ ls foo Memory Stick M?moire t?l?phone So probably, there's a encoding problem here. If I launch nautilus on foo, I can browse my phone without any problem (just a problem with fonts of M?moire T?l?phone. Any tips ? because gnome-phone seems simply unusable for me.
